/*
* EXAMPLE_START(LEPeripheral): LE Peripheral
*
* @text BTstack allows to setup a GATT Services and Characteristics directly
* from the setup function without using other tools outside of the Arduino IDE.
*
* @section Setup
*
* @text First, a number of callbacks are set. Then, a Service with a Read-only
* Characteristic and a dynamic Characteristic is added to the GATT database.
* In BTstack, a dynamic Characteristic is a Characteristic where reads and writes
* are forwarded to the Sketch. In this example, the dynamic Characteristic is
* provided by the single byte variable characteristic_data.
*/

/*
* @section Read Callback
*
* @text In BTstack, the Read Callback is first called to query the size of the
* Charcteristic Value, before it is called to provide the data.
* Both times, the size has to be returned. The data is only stored in the provided
* buffer, if the buffer argeument is not NULL.
* If more than one dynamic Characteristics is used, the value handle is used
* to distinguish them.
*/
